Understanding HDMI NDI Converters

Before delving into the use with a barcode scanner, it's essential to understand what an HDMI NDI converter is. NDI (NewTek Device Integration) is a revolutionary technology that allows video sources to be sent and received over a standard IP network. An HDMI NDI converter takes an HDMI video signal and converts it into an NDI stream, which can then be transmitted over a network. This technology has opened up a world of possibilities for video production, allowing for easy sharing and distribution of video content across multiple devices and locations.

Barcode Scanners in Video - Related Applications

Barcode scanners are commonly used in retail, logistics, and inventory management to quickly and accurately read barcodes. However, in video - related applications, barcode scanners can serve a different purpose. For example, in a video production environment, barcode scanners can be used to trigger specific actions or events. A barcode on a prop or a set piece could be scanned to start a particular video clip, change the lighting setup, or initiate a special effect.

Feasibility of Using an HDMI NDI Converter with a Barcode Scanner

The feasibility of using an HDMI NDI converter with a barcode scanner depends on the specific requirements of the video - related application. In theory, it is possible to integrate the two devices. The barcode scanner can be connected to a computer or a control system, which can then send commands based on the scanned barcode. Meanwhile, the HDMI NDI converter can be used to transmit video signals from a camera or other video sources over the network.

If the barcode scanner is used to trigger a change in the video feed, the control system can send a signal to the NDI - enabled devices. For example, if a barcode is scanned, the control system can instruct an NDI - enabled switcher to change the input source. The HDMI NDI converter can then transmit the new video signal over the network to the desired destinations, such as monitors or recording devices.

Potential Challenges

  1. Compatibility Issues: Ensuring compatibility between the barcode scanner, the control system, and the HDMI NDI converter can be a challenge. Different barcode scanners may have different output formats and communication protocols. The control system needs to be able to interpret the barcode data and send appropriate commands to the NDI - enabled devices. It is crucial to test the compatibility of all components before implementing the system.
  2. Network Reliability: Since NDI relies on an IP network, network reliability is of utmost importance. Any network issues, such as latency or packet loss, can affect the quality of the video transmission. In addition, the barcode scanner and the control system also rely on the network to communicate. Therefore, a stable and high - speed network infrastructure is required to ensure the smooth operation of the system.
  3. Security Concerns: With the integration of multiple devices and the use of a network, security becomes a significant concern. The barcode scanner and the HDMI NDI converter may be vulnerable to cyber - attacks. It is essential to implement proper security measures, such as firewalls and encryption, to protect the system from unauthorized access and data breaches.
